Cheapest effective thing is to uprate the ARBs.

After that,change the exhaust and get a decent intake,and move to STg2 or 2+.

After that,everything is expensive.

Stiffer ARBs lessen the tendency to understeer and roll on cornering.

Improves the handling,and makes the most of the power you have.
